Command Syntax
:WMEMory{1:8}:UDEFined:BASe amplitude
<amplitude> is a double.
Where the {1:8} specifier identifies one of eight possible waveform memories. For example, :WMEMory4
.
Query Syntax
:WMEMory{1:8}:UDEFined:BASe?
Description
For the indicated waveform memory, sets the custom base-level. The top and base levels are used to locate a waveform's lower, middle, and upper threshold levels during the following measurements: duty-cycle distortion, rise time and fall time. Specify the level in volts or Watts depending on the waveform type. Use :WMEMory{1:8}:UDEFined:TOP
to set or query a custom top level.
Before this custom base level can be applied to measurements, use the :MEASure:TBASe:METHod
command to select custom top-base definitions.
Example Command Sequence
:MEASure:TBASe:METHod UDEFined :WMEMory2:UDEFined:BASe -125E-3 :WMEMory2:UDEFined:TOP 125E-3
